
Melissa Frangiosa
Fleet Safety Director, Schnitzer Steel Industries
Melissa Frangiosa is a Certified Director of Safety with 16 years of experience in a corporate transportation environment. She provides leadership and change management as it relates to safety and compliance, driver qualification, policies and procedures, measured incident improvement, and implementing a safety culture. She completed and passed five onsite DOT audits and maintains close relationships with the DOT and FMCSA to ensure continued compliance and understanding of DOT and FMCSA regulations. Frangiosa also specializes in developing safety strategies to reduce CSA scores and identified significant cost savings opportunities.

Trucking/ Transportation Regulations and Responsibility – “What you need to know”
Meeting Room 202 A-C: Level 2
Track:
Safety and Security 🛈Topics may include those focused on protecting the health and life of recycling facility employees, customers, visitors, contractors, drivers, and the surrounding community; OSHA compliance; disaster preparedness; hazardous materials management; hazard recognition; safety culture; law enforcement; theft; cybersecurity; and infectious disease.
Commercial Vehicle Safety Regulations can be complicated and confusing. Learn from a panel of experts as they share information and answer your questions on hiring drivers, maintaining driver files, and more.
